10 simple tips to fall back asleep after waking up at night

             Written by: Mantasha

Struggling to fall back asleep after waking up at night? Try these easy tips to help you drift off again and enjoy restful sleep.

Use earplugs, a fan, or white noise to mask disturbing sounds.

Block Out Noise

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

 If you can’t sleep after 15 minutes, move to another room and do something relaxing.

Leave Your Bed

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Don’t stare at the clock, as it can make you anxious and harder to sleep.

 Avoid the Clock

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Blue light from devices can interfere with your sleep. Turn them off or use blue light-blocking glasses.

Turn Off Screens

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Use the 4-7-8 method: inhale for 4 seconds, hold for 7, and exhale for 8.

Try Breathing Exercises

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Perform a body scan by relaxing muscles from head to toe.

Relax Your Muscles

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Avoid bright lights as they reduce melatonin production.

Keep Lights Off

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Count sheep or think of something dull to help you doze off.

Focus on Something Boring

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Soft music can soothe your mind and block out noise.

Listen to Calm Music

Photo Credit: Shutterstock

Apps with calming sounds, music, and stories can help you relax.

Use Sleep Apps
